The House of Representatives to decide on Increase of the Excise Taxes on May 10

Published: April 28, 2017
Share
SHARE

parliamentThe final decision on the increase of excise duties on oil and oil derivatives in BiH will be made at the 45th session of the House of Representatives of the Parliamentary Assembly of BiH, which will take place on May 10, 2017.

During this session, MPs will discuss a number of points, but the most interesting points will be the ones that are concerning the amendments to the reform of laws, including the one on excise duties.

This time, representatives of the House of Representatives will discuss the Law on Excise on the shortened procedure, after they rejected discussion of this law in an emergency procedure twice.

Also, the discussion on the Law on Administration, the basics of traffic safety on the roads in BiH, as well as discussions on two loans that BiH is taking from the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development, which will be used to continue with the construction of Corridor 5C and the Port of Brcko, will be especially interesting.

To recall, amendments to the law on excise duties caused the great attention of the entire public in a recent couple of weeks, since this type of change would cause a direct increase in prices of fuel. Thus, oil and petroleum products would be increased by 15 fenings, and these funds would be used for the construction of roads and highways in our country.
